<p>At sixty-six, Jake Walker thinks he’s ready for some peace and quiet. He’s a Vietnam veteran, former POW, recent widower, and retired SWAT team commander with the Houston Police Department, so he looks for a new life of leisure in the small town of Rockriver, Texas. But adventure finds him even when he’s not looking for it. Before he knows it, a forty-year-old cold case murder catches his attention, and he is on the trail of crime and corruption—and something more. Camy Jo Parker is a divorcée who seems to be interested in more than Jake’s abilities as a detective. Will Jake find a new career and lease on life in what seemed to be a sleepy small town?</p><p><em>While Justice Sleeps: Secrets in a Small Town</em> is Jerry Snodgrass’s twelfth novel. <em>While Justice Sleeps</em> not only fictionalizes Snodgrass’s experiences with the military but also preserves stories of the small-town life, as one by one small-town police departments are shut down.<br />
